We present the design and themeasured performance of a compact quad-ridge orthomode transducer (OMT) operating in C-band with more than 100% fractional bandwidth. The OMT comprises two sets of identical orthogonal ridges mounted in a circular waveguide. The profile of these ridges was optimized to reduce significantly the transition length, while retaining the wide operational bandwidth of the quad-ridge OMT. In this letter, we show that the optimized compact OMT has better than -15 dB return loss with the cross polarization well below -40 dB in the designated 4.0-8.5 GHz band.
